Full Job Description
Summary of role

We are seeking an Associate Director of 3PL Operations. As an Associate Director for Cold Chain Pharmaceuticals and Radioactive Pharmaceuticals with a focus on 3PL (Third-Party Logistics) Management, your role will involve a range of responsibilities to ensure the safe and efficient handling, storage, and transportation of pharmaceutical products, particularly those requiring temperature control and those classified as radioactive. As the Associate Director, you will play a crucial role in overseeing the end-to-end logistics and supply chain operations for cold chain and radioactive pharmaceuticals. Your primary focus will be on managing third-party logistics providers to guarantee the integrity and compliance of the supply chain.

This position is based in Massachusetts and requires a presence on-site 3+ days per week, and open to applicants authorized to work for any employer within the United States.

Responsibilities
  1. Strategy Development:
    • Develop and implement strategic plans for the cold chain and radioactive pharmaceuticals logistics, ensuring alignment with overall business objectives.
    • Evaluate market trends, industry best practices, and regulatory requirements to enhance logistics strategies.
  2. 3PL Management:
    • Select, negotiate contracts with, and manage relationships with third-party logistics providers.
    • Oversee the performance of 3PL partners to ensure adherence to quality standards, regulatory compliance, and service level agreements.
  3. Cold Chain Management:
    • Implement and maintain robust processes for the storage, handling, and transportation of temperature-sensitive pharmaceuticals.
    • Ensure compliance with Good Distribution Practices (GDP) and other relevant regulations.
  4. Radioactive Pharmaceuticals Management:
    • Develop and implement procedures for the secure handling, transportation, and storage of radioactive pharmaceuticals in compliance with regulatory requirements.
  5. Compliance and Quality Assurance:
    • Establish and maintain quality assurance measures for the entire supply chain, ensuring compliance with industry standards and regulations.
    • Conduct regular audits and assessments to identify areas for improvement.
  6. Cross-functional Collaboration:
    • Collaborate with other departments, including regulatory affairs, quality control, and manufacturing, to ensure seamless coordination across the supply chain.
  7. Risk Management:
    • Identify and mitigate potential risks related to cold chain and radioactive pharmaceutical logistics.
    • Develop contingency plans to address unforeseen challenges.
  8. Continuous Improvement:
    • Drive continuous improvement initiatives in logistics processes to enhance efficiency, reduce costs, and optimize overall performance.

About Lantheus Holdings

Lantheus Holdings is a medical imaging company that develops, manufactures, and commercializes diagnostic imaging agents and products. The company's products are used in a variety of medical imaging procedures, including cardiovascular, oncological, and neurological imaging. Lantheus Holdings was founded in 1956 and is headquartered in North Billerica, Massachusetts. The company operates through two segments: Diagnostic Imaging and Therapeutic Imaging. The Diagnostic Imaging segment includes the production and sale of diagnostic imaging agents, while the Therapeutic Imaging segment includes the production and sale of therapeutic imaging agents. Lantheus Holdings is committed to developing innovative products that improve patient outcomes and has a strong track record of success in this area.
